Output c3768f6a6552313c0cabb005ffb8a6ba6b3a59e05bad5511aa83772f7b1e3b11:1

value
21963967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0939dd505470b160084f15568dbdabd5af2dfaae OP_EQUAL
address
32XoKmRHeCxvcE7zCzuUXzPs9NQGiAx6Jf
transaction
c3768f6a6552313c0cabb005ffb8a6ba6b3a59e05bad5511aa83772f7b1e3b11
spent
true